Transcultural Perspectives on Transformations
In 2025, Transcultural Caravan Network (TCN) and the Bodensee Innovation Cluster (BIC) invite you to a dynamic hybrid event exploring the intersections of digital, social, and cultural transformations and transitions. Designed for practitioners and students from our networks, this gathering connects diverse perspectives and expertise.
This event will take place on 13 and 14 November 2025, with local events at Zeppelin University, HFU Business School (Furtwangen/Schwenningen), University of Pretoria, and other partners of the TCN and BIC.
As transformations accelerate, the upcoming years will demand innovative approaches to business models, leadership, organizational strategies, and collaboration across various stakeholders. New technologies, such as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ML), are transforming industries, while changes in how we work, including “new work” trends, are challenging traditional leadership, management, and teamwork models. These changes call for companies not only to adapt but to harness these transitions productively.
The two-day event is designed to explore exactly these shifts. On Thursday, internal formats will be developed that focus exclusively on students of Zeppelin University, fostering early-stage ideas and dialogue in a more intimate setting. The main event will take place on Friday in a hybrid format, bringing together international partners and participants from various fields.
A central element of the event will be the World Café on Friday, an interactive group process centered around transformational questions. As a unique and transculturally adapted format, the World Café invites participants from diverse backgrounds to engage in meaningful dialogue and collaborative reflection. Designed to facilitate open exchange, it offers a space to explore complex challenges and co-create ideas across cultures and disciplines.
In addition, the event features a panel discussion with approximately four distinguished speakers from different professional sectors who will share their insights on current transformation dynamics. A series of impulse talks—short, ten-minute “impressions”—will further inspire attendees with fresh perspectives and provocative questions.

Connecting the BIC and TCN networks for a unique learning opportunity
The idea for the foundation of the Bodensee Innovation Cluster lies in the fundamental conviction that the Lake Constance region as one of the most innovative technology regions in Europe has extensive explicit as well as implicit knowledge about the framework conditions, consequences and above all opportunities in the context of the digital transformation in the economy and industry Company. Against this background, the Leadership Excellence Institute Zeppelin (LEIZ) is pursuing the goal of promoting the future viability of highly industrialized and highly innovative locations such as the Lake Constance region by setting up the BIC. The Transcultural Caravan Network is an alliance of universities from different countries around the world that share the goal of facilitating international and interdisciplinary research projects and transcultural learning experiences for students, educators, and practitioners. It is organized by the Leadership Excellence Institute Zeppelin (LEIZ) at Zeppelin University, with support from the Baden-Württemberg-STIPENDIUM program. The network emphasizes and strengthens transcultural leadership, encouraging participants to explore global challenges through interdisciplinary projects, events, and cooperation across cultural boundaries.
